The world of Metroidvania-style games has seen a resurgence in recent years, and one title that has garnered significant attention is Bloodstained: Ritual of the Night. Developed by ArtPlay and published by 505 Games, this side-scrolling action game was initially released in 2019 for PC, PlayStation 4, and Xbox One. Since then, it has made its way to the Nintendo Switch, offering players another platform to indulge in its gothic charm and intense gameplay. Bloodstained: Ritual of the Night, the spiritual successor to the legendary Castlevania: Symphony of the Night , is a masterclass in Metroidvania design. While the game launched across multiple platforms, the Nintendo Switch version—often searched for by its file format, —holds a unique place in the community. It offers the ultimate portable experience, allowing players to hunt demons anywhere, though this convenience came with a historically rocky performance journey.
